And also, all the names of the Kitsune Digimon are based on some different types of Kitsune. Here they are:
Bakemono - a name for a sorcerer or evil fox
Byakko - white fox, a very good omen usually a sign of serving Inari
Koryo - haunting fox
Kiko - spirit fox
Kuko - air fox, very bad kitsune
